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ong

The NM_024783.4(AGBL2):​c.2013G>A​(p.Met671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
AGBL2 (HGNC:26296): (AGBL carboxypeptidase 2) Predicted to enable metallocarboxypeptidase activity. Predicted to be involved in protein side chain deglutamylation. Located in centriole and ciliary basal body. [provided by Alliance of Genome Resources, Apr 2022]
